Philips IntelliVue G5 M1019A

The Philips IntelliVue G5 M1019A anesthetic gas modules measure the five most commonly used anesthetic gases, as well as nitrous oxide (N2O) and carbon dioxide (CO2). Waveforms for all gases are displayed on the connected patient monitor along with inspiratory and end-tidal numerical values. The IntelliVue G5 automatically identifies agents and features mixed-agent measurement capabilities. The compact footprint of the IntelliVue gas modules makes them practical for use in lower-acuity settings. At the same time, advanced capabilities such as automatic agent ID and mixed-agent measurements are available for higher-acuity environments. The gas sensors in the G5 gas modules have no moving parts, so they are reliable and durable. Zero calibrations are completed automatically during warm-up.

Philips IntelliVue G5 M1019A Specifications

Dimensions

  • Size: 90 x 370 x 467 mm 3.54 x 14.5 x 18.4 in
  • Weight: 6.3 kg 13.9 lb
  • Gas analyzer: M1026BAGM

Power

  • Power Consumption: peak: 35W, typical: 25W
  • Power Range: 100 – 240 VAC

Enviromential Specifications

  • Temperature Range
    • Operating 10 to 40°C (50 to 104°F)
    • Non-operating -20 to 65°C (-4 to 149°F)
  • Humidity Range
    • Operating 5 to 90%
    • Relative Humidity (RH) max. @ 40°C (104°F) (non-condensing)
    • Non-operating 5 to 95% Relative Humidity (RH) max. @ 65°C (150°F)
  • Altitude Range
    • Operating -305 m to 2900 m (-1000 to 9515 ft)
    • Non-operating -305 m to 5000 m (-1000 to 16404 ft)
  • Atmospheric Pressure Range
    • Operating 70 kPa to 106 kPa
    • Non-operating 50kPa to 106 kPa
  • Warmup Time After switching on: 1 – 2 minutes to measure, 6 minutes for full accuracy
